pied
adjective/paɪd/
Frequency rank: #12,814 most common English word
Meaning
Having patches of two or more colors; multicolored.

Example sentence
The children were delighted by the pied horse standing in the meadow.
Synonyms & related words
- spotted
- patchy
- multicolored
- mottled
